Chapter 39 Regret & Redemption (6)

  • In the aftermath of the girl's departure, the room, bathed in a deep red hue, sank into silence. Dane found himself sitting on the bed, his gaze drawn to the large window that offered a view distinct from that of the balcony.
  • He watched quietly as the moon gradually dipped behind the hills, casting a reddish tinge across the edges of the sky. Soon, the sun began to rise, appearing as a distant, reddish-yellow disc.
  • The gentle breeze brushed against his cheeks, yet he remained motionless and utterly lost in his thoughts.
